About this campaign
The Latin colony of Cosa (modern Ansedonia), located about 140km up the Italian coast from Rome, was founded by Romans in 273 BCE. Excavations on this site, which is integral to the understanding of ancient Roman colonial life, first began in 1948, but several areas of the colony remain unexcavated. Excavations have therefore been recently renewed under the auspices of Bryn Mawr, and the University of Tuebingen. Because it is cheaper to live off site, we need your help funding our transportation to and from the excavations daily during this 70th anniversary year!
